Been coming here for quite a few years and I honestly do really enjoy this place, but I?ve had some experiences here this year... that make me not frequent this place like I used to. One time, it took about an hour for me and my party just to get our food.We were only a party of six and saw at least 15 people walk in, order, and walk out with food after we had ordered. Spokane?sfood scene is also changing rapidly and ingredient quality has only improved, but this place has fallen behind. It also feelslike a 50/50 chance theyre out of something when I go eat here, whether its coleslaw or fried chicken. It?s not like I?m walkingin ten minutes before they close - so it?s weird when staples aren?t even available. The employee working the register (nomatter who it is) is also just a bystander most of the time. It would help immensely if they were able to process orders fasterto help in the kitchen. It goes without saying that if you do want to take someone to a casual Spokane staple, this is still adecent option. However, this place could certainly improve. If a chain chicken restaurant ever pops up downtown - this placecould be history. Recommend for the food, just not the experience. Read more

Here's the deal. If I would have rated this place immediately after my dining experience, I probably would have only given them... 3 stars. First of all, the chicken was delicious! Secondly, the service, though extremely slow, was very friendly. We camein right before noon on a Tuesday and ordered. It took an hour for our food. That's cool if you're not in a hurry, but we allneeded to get back to work so this was not a good idea. If you are meeting up with someone and you need some time to catch upwith each other, this is the place to go! If you are in a hurry and want to grab a quick bite, not so much. Like I saidearlier, the chicken was good and I think it's very important to support local businesses. They are celebrating 30 years ofbeing in business this year. I just hope they can pick up the pace getting food out to their customers. I waited in line toorder. I waited in line to pick up my food once they called my name. And then finally, I had to wait in line a third and finaltime to pay for my food after I was done eating. Not very efficient. Read more
